TROY, MI (January 16, 2020) – The American Collegiate Hockey Association (ACHA) has today released Ranking #7 of the 2019-20 season for Men’s Division 2, which details the Top 20 eligible teams from each of M2’s Northeast, Southeast, Central and West regions as of January 12, 2020.
2019-2020 ACHA Division 2 Ranking #7 | ||
NORTHEAST | ||
Rank | School | Rating |
1 | Univ of Mass-Amherst | 12.995 |
2 | Keene State College | 12.650 |
3 | University of New Hampshire | 11.000 |
4 |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ute | 10.936 |
5 | Northeastern University | 10.800 |
6 | Westfield State College | 10.447 |
7 | Boston College | 10.424 |
8 | Roger Williams University | 10.171 |
9 | Boston University | 9.950 |
10 | Providence College | 9.733 |
11 | Marist College | 9.371 |
12 | Bentley University | 9.154 |
13 | Sacred Heart University | 9.053 |
14 | Clarkson University | 8.900 |
15 | Bryant University | 8.800 |
16 | College of Holy Cross | 8.477 |
17 | Univ of Mass-Lowell | 8.200 |
18 | Saint Anselm College | 8.167 |
19 | Norwich University | 8.100 |
20 | Merrimack College | 7.975 |
